The Biggest Myth

What is a myth?
“A myth is a widely held but false belief or idea.”

What is balance?
“An even distribution of weight enabling someone or something to remain upright and steady.”

As a Chinese Medicine practitioner, I often talk about balance & harmony. I use acupuncture, fire cupping, moxibustion, and herbs as tools to cultivate optimal qi (life force) in the mind-body-spirit.  But is total balance & harmony realistic in this crazy thing we call life?  Or are we all chasing a myth? A perfect story with a perfect ending?

This tweet from Randi Zukerberg got me thinking:

Picture

In just one tweet, she asked an incredibly challenging question…

If there are 5 keys to a balanced life:

  1. Friends
  2. Work
  3. Family
  4. Fitness
  5. Sleep

How many can you do well? One? Three? Five(!)?

I’ll give an honest answer: At this point in my life, I can only do 2 (work & family). There is simply not enough qi or time in my day(s) to excel in the other areas. Yes, some days I hit the jackpot and can add sleep to make it 3, but nights with more than 7 hours of sleep are truly rare.

So, why are we all chasing this myth of having a perfect symphony of days spent cultivating friendships, building empires at work, spending quality time with family, exercising & eating well, and sleeping like a log every night? 

​More importantly, what is missing from this list in your life? Spirituality? Simple downtime?

Chinese Medicine is awesome at cultivating qi, but the truth is no one is in perfect balance & harmony, all of the time. It’s a myth, a fabricated story. They key is to pick what is right for you at this time in your life and the rest will follow in its own time.
